After a powerful earthquake struck southern Japan, a duck hospital opened its doors for disaster survivors and their pets, welcoming both patients and animals into dedicated facilities to provide a safe environment following the destruction of infrastructure and the halt of essential services. The hospital director added that animals are often psychologically affected during disasters, and that the hospital is keen to keep animals with their owners to reduce stress, especially after the devastating earthquake in 2016 which claimed many lives and left thousands without electricity or water.
